The province of Nuoro, commonly considered capital of the Barbagia, occupies the central part of the Sardinia, of the eastern and west coast: the territory mainly hill and montainous, is what has better preserved the natural environment, rich of forests, stains mediterraneas, harsh and savages landscapes and coasts little crowded. More of the half of the territory is occupeded from pastures, about a fourth one from forest, the remainder from sowed and wooden cultivations. Nuoro is for tradiction the spiritual and cultural homeland of sardi to remember: Grazia Deledda, sebastiano Satta, Antonio Ballero, Francesco Ciusa, Salvatore Satta. The parties and the festivals nuoresi are: La Sagra del Redentore the last sunday of August, the party of Nostra Signora delle Grazie to November, the festival of San Francesco of Lula to October, the party of Santo Antonio Abate to January and the Sagra of Carnevale. The typical speciality nuoresi are at base of meat, but enjoy excellent flat firsts of fresh pasta, cheeses, sweets and red wines the "Cannonau" and strong, fragrant liquor like "Mirto" and the "Filu 'e Ferru". |
